So Stacy X was in this one too, back at the ranch with her memories. See, I've had this little theory on the back burner, and I've been watching the past few issues of Uncanny to be sure.
I've read (but don't have) every issue with Stacy in it, and every time she's been with a client, she has had a very strict 'no touch' policy. She also mentions in 416 something about her scales keeping her step-father from "..." I think we can take a wild guess as to what she's referring to.
Also, she makes very sure that everyone and anyone around her knows she was a prostitute before an X-Man, almost desperately so.
And then the whole 'kiss' thing with Warren. She's making a bigger deal out of it than entirely necessary.

Now I ask, was that (almost) perhaps, if not her first, one of her first actual kisses? Could she not be nearly (if at all) experienced as she lets on?
